Output a62670116d156ab04013bbbb17073848bcc7c890a29f6fa433929541fb838ed4:51

value
3617932
script pubkey
OP_0 OP_PUSHBYTES_32 75f1b321c9b84f9ef17998d797df1e80f900a0ba64124b17aeb0fee98a516358
address
bc1qwhcmxgwfhp8eautenrte0hc7sruspg96vsfyk9awkrlwnzj3vdvqn7rd3t
transaction
a62670116d156ab04013bbbb17073848bcc7c890a29f6fa433929541fb838ed4
spent
true